


Created/changed by:
System

Gedi, Spain
Category: Local business
Address details
C/Llull27-39
2n9ª
08005 Barcelona
Spain
Barcelona, Spain Print route » N41° 23' 45.96" E2° 12' 1.188" (41.3961, 2.20033)

Phone & WWW


Business hours
Mon: 9:00 am - 5:00 pmTue: 9:00 am - 5:00 pm
Wed: 9:00 am - 5:00 pm
Thu: 9:00 am - 5:00 pm
Fri: 9:00 am - 5:00 pm
Sat:
Sun: